Ingredients
  

  • 1/2 cup This section may contain affiliate links to products we know and love.Mayonnaise
  • 1/4 cup This section may contain affiliate links to products we know and love.Honey
  • 1/4 cup This section may contain affiliate links to products we know and love.Dijon Mustard
  • 1 tablespoon yellow mustard
  • 1 tablespoon This section may contain affiliate links to products we know and love.Lemon Juice
  • Pinch of salt
  • Optional: A sprinkle of paprika or a dash of cayenne for an added kick!

Instructions

  • In a mixing bowl, combine the mayonnaise, honey, Dijon mustard, and yellow mustard. Whisk until everything is well blended.
  • Add the lemon juice and a pinch of salt to the mixture. Whisk again until smooth.
  • For those adventurous young chefs, add a sprinkle of paprika or a dash of cayenne to give it a little zing! Remember, always taste as you go.
  • Once everything’s well mixed, transfer the dip to an airtight container. Although you can enjoy it immediately, letting it chill in the refrigerator for an hour allows the flavors to meld beautifully.
  • Grab those chicken nuggets and dive right in!

Notes

Note: This sauce isn’t just limited to chicken nuggets. It pairs wonderfully with veggies, sandwiches, and even salads. So, let your imagination run wild and dip away!
